Struct microbit::hal::pac::ficr::RegisterBlock [−]
#[repr(C)]pub struct RegisterBlock { pub codepagesize: Reg<u32, _CODEPAGESIZE>, pub codesize: Reg<u32, _CODESIZE>, pub deviceid: [Reg<u32, _DEVICEID>; 2], pub er: [Reg<u32, _ER>; 4], pub ir: [Reg<u32, _IR>; 4], pub deviceaddrtype: Reg<u32, _DEVICEADDRTYPE>, pub deviceaddr: [Reg<u32, _DEVICEADDR>; 2], pub info: INFO, pub prodtest: [Reg<u32, _PRODTEST>; 3], pub temp: TEMP, pub nfc: NFC, // some fields omitted }
Expand description
Register block
Fields
codepagesize: Reg<u32, _CODEPAGESIZE>0x10 - Code memory page size
codesize: Reg<u32, _CODESIZE>0x14 - Code memory size
deviceid: [Reg<u32, _DEVICEID>; 2]0x60 - Description collection: Device identifier
er: [Reg<u32, _ER>; 4]0x80 - Description collection: Encryption root, word n
ir: [Reg<u32, _IR>; 4]0x90 - Description collection: Identity Root, word n
deviceaddrtype: Reg<u32, _DEVICEADDRTYPE>0xa0 - Device address type
deviceaddr: [Reg<u32, _DEVICEADDR>; 2]0xa4 - Description collection: Device address n
info: INFO0x100 - Device info
prodtest: [Reg<u32, _PRODTEST>; 3]0x350 - Description collection: Production test signature n
temp: TEMP0x404 - Registers storing factory TEMP module linearization coefficients
nfc: NFC0x450 - Unspecified
